    Why go

    Morioka yakiniku institution earning Tabelog 100 recognition seven years running (2019–2025) at the rare sub-JPY 2,000 price tier. The 144-seat restaurant, open since 1981, handles high-volume service while maintaining grill quality and a strong offal program anchored by tripe and Korean cold noodles.

    Ambiance

    Bustling, casual yakiniku dining room on the 2nd floor of GEN Plaza, with a classic Japanese BBQ atmosphere that stays lively and crowded, especially at night and on weekends, drawing both locals and visitors for noodles and grilled meat.

    Restaurant context

    At JPY 1,000–1,999, Seirokaku slots below Morioka's other peer options while holding a Tabelog 100 pedigree none of them can match. Golot runs JPY 6,000–7,999 for dinner and JPY 2,000–2,999 for lunch, positioning it as the splurge pick if you want a quieter room and premium beef cuts. Kakashi Ya operates at a similar JPY 6,000–7,999 bracket and skews toward kaiseki-influenced presentation rather than straight grill-it-yourself yakiniku, making it the better call if the meal is a special occasion. Aji no Mise Iwashi sits at JPY 4,000–4,999 and focuses on seafood rather than beef, so it's not a direct alternative unless you're rotating categories across nights. The bar Sato, also at JPY 4,000–4,999, pivots to cocktails and izakaya fare rather than yakiniku, making it a post-dinner option rather than a replacement.

    The value calculation is straightforward: Seirokaku delivers the most beef and offal per yen while maintaining recognition that none of the higher-priced peers can claim. If you're booking one yakiniku meal in Morioka and want to leave room in the budget for sake and extra rounds, this is the pick. If you're chasing a quieter ambiance or kaiseki-level plating, redirect to Golot or Kakashi Ya and accept the price jump. Fukuda Pan Nagata chou honten operates at under JPY 999 as a bakery rather than a sit-down restaurant, so it's breakfast or takeaway only, not a yakiniku alternative.

    For solo diners or couples prioritizing price and grill quality over atmosphere, Seirokaku is the correct first stop. For groups of four or more who want private-room flexibility without the JPY 6,000+ tier, the restaurant's four tatami rooms deliver separation the open-floor peers can't match. If you can't secure a reservation during peak periods (year-end, Golden Week, Obon), pivot to Golot, which typically holds capacity better due to its smaller footprint and higher price deterrent. If Golot is full, Aji no Mise Iwashi offers a seafood pivot at mid-tier pricing rather than forcing you into the sub-JPY 2,000 bracket where quality drops sharply outside Seirokaku.
